Comparison of the GW residuals RMS induced by the HORIZON-AGN population, using different modeling and populations, with the spectrum measured by the EPTA collaboration, shown in red. The average GE spectra of both circular and eccentric ensembles are depicted as solid and dashed lines, respectively. The distribution of the maximum-a-posteriori samples for the GWB spectra of the 2000 Universe realizations obtained using the population (Pop) method and a realistic PTA-like inference with and without TMM, are shown in dashed contours and light blue color, respectively, for the circular population. The effect of spectral leakage on the GWB inference results in a shallower spectral shape, significantly biasing the inference when TMM is not included. For some Universe realizations, spectral leakage still has appreciable effects at high frequencies even when TMM is applied.
